Genesis 18:26-32 New International Reader's Version (NIRV)

26. The Lord said, "If I find 50 godly people in the city of Sodom, I will save it. I will spare the whole place because of them."

27. Then Abraham spoke up again. He said, "I have been very bold to speak to the Lord. After all, I'm only dust and ashes.

28. What if the number of godly people is five less than 50? Will you destroy the whole city because of five people?" "If I find 45 there," he said, "I will not destroy it."

29. Once again Abraham spoke to him. He asked, "What if only 40 are found there?" He said, "If there are 40, I will not do it."

30. Then Abraham said, "Lord, don't let your anger burn against me. Let me speak. What if only 30 can be found there?" He answered, "If there are 30, I will not do it."

31. Abraham said, "I have been very bold to speak to the Lord. What if only 20 are found there?" He said, "If there are 20, I will not destroy it."

32. Then he said, "Lord, don't let your anger burn against me. Let me speak just one more time. What if only ten are found there?" He answered, "If there are ten, I will not destroy it."
